Image Processing with Virtual Pencil and Virtual Mouse using Webcam Recognition for Drawing
Abstract
Recently, people use physical mouse to control the computer. Virtual Vpaint can be a new innovation to change the physical mouse to virtual mouse, then the users can minimize the cost of hardware consumption and damages. Having virtual mouse, users can control the computer only through webcam to do a lot of things such as drawing, editing images, mouse control, and others. Virtual VPaint application will discuss the development of Computer Vision for drawing an object in Windows form application by using virtual mouse. This application can perform common image editor such as blurring, gray scaling, and negating images. Users can control mouse pointer through the webcam by using object mover which has specific color, then can draw an object on canvas by using virtual pencil.
Full Text:
PDFReferences
Advantages and Disadvantages RAD (Accessed 7 October 2015) http://www. my-project-management-expert.com/the-advantages-and-disadvantages-of-rad-software-development.html
Arithmetic Mean. Jose, D. Perezgonzales. Arithmetic Mean, 2012
Blur Image (Accessed 10 October 2015) https://futurestud.io/.../how-to-blur-images-efficiently-with-androids-ren
Chart windows usage (Accessed 7 October 2015) https://www.netmarket share.com/operating-system-market-share.aspx?qprid=10&qpcustomd=0& qp timeframe=Y
Computer Definition Concept. Herbert Bay, Tinne Tuytelaars, and Luc Van Gool. SURF: Speeded up robust features. In European Conference on Computer Vision, 2006
Computer Vision CS291A00. “Computer Vision I”, University of California, San Diego, 2004
Computer Vision Definition. (Accessed 9 October 2015) http://programming computervision. com/
Convolution. Wendy, Manipulasi Citra Wajah pada Webcam untuk Aplikasi Skype, 2014
Convolution and Image Processing (Accessed 9 October 2015) Hirschman, Isidore and Widder, David Vernon. The Convolution Transform, 2012
Convolution Kernel (Accessed 10 October 2015) http://dev.theomader.com /gaussian-kernel-calculator/
First Mouse (Accessed 7 October 2015) https://en.wikipedia.org/wiki/Mouse _(computing)
First Webcam (Accessed 7 October 2015) https://en.wikipedia.org/wiki/ Trojan_Room_coffee_pot
Grayscale (Accessed 9 October 2015) https://en.wikipedia.org/wiki/Grayscale
Human Computer Interaction (Accessed 9 October 2015) https://www.interaction-design.org/ literature/book/the- encyclopedia-of-human-computer-interaction-2nd-ed/human-computer-interaction-brief-intro
Kinect (Accessed 10 October 2015) https://dev.windows.com/en-us/kinect
Leap Motion (Accessed 10 October 2015) www.engadget.com/2013/ 07/22/leap-motion-controller-review/
Negative Image (Accessed 10 October 2015) www.imageprocessing place.com/DIPUM2E_Chapter03_Pgs_80-114_
Object Recognition Process (Accessed 9 October 2015) Thomas B. Moeslund and Erik Granum, “A Survey of Computer Vision-Based Human Motion Capture,” Elsevier, Computer Vision and Image Understanding, 2001
OpenCV (Accessed 9 October 2015) http://www.seas.upenn.edu/~ bensapp/opencvdocs/ref/opencvref_cv.htm.
OpenCV EmguCV (Accessed 9 October 2015) http://opencv.org/
Relative_luminance (Accessed 10 October 2015) https://en.wikipedia.org/wiki/Relative_luminance
Virtual Mouse Concept (Accessed 9 October 2015) http://classes.engr.oregon state.edu/eecs/fall2013/ece441/project.php?ID=30
DOI: http://dx.doi.org/10.33021/itfs.v1i1.17
Refbacks
- There are currently no refbacks.
Copyright (c) 2016 IT for Society
All articles in this journal are indexed in:
This work is lic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License.